#6101d7 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6101d7 is composed of 38% red, 0.4% green and 84.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.9% cyan, 99.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 266.9 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 42.4%. #6101d7 color hex could be obtained by blending #c202ff with #0000af.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#6101d7 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6101d7 has RGB values of R:97, G:1, B:215 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:1,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 6357463.
